Another comics related blog I’ve taken to frequenting belongs to King Hell proprieter Rick Veitch. There he’s recently posted a fake advert. he created which originally appeared on the back cover of the first issue of the 1963 mini-series from image. I remember laughing like a drain throughout a forty-five minute bus ride when I first read it, and took it as evidence of Alan Moore’s comic genius (for it was he who wrote the comic itself). I was surprised to discover Veitch was the actual writer and feel that linking here assuages any guilt I may have felt.
